Considering the impact of the pandemic on creating a safe environment, what are some of the challenges you and your peers are currently experiencing?

In the immediate aftermath of the pandemic, one of the most challenging aspects has been the recovery process. The ever-changing nature of the information surrounding COVID-19 necessitated a dynamic approach that relied on constantly adapting to new data. Consequently, it was crucial to acknowledge the inherent uncertainty and be accountable for the decisions made during that time. However, as the environment has become more stable and we now have the ability to gather and rely on long-term information, we can implement programs with a greater sense of confidence. This transition to a more stable phase allows us to extend the efforts put in place during the recovery phase.

Undoubtedly, one of the most significant challenges lies in the burnout experienced by healthcare professionals. The impact of COVID-19 on mental health within the healthcare sector has been profound. We are witnessing a substantial decrease in individuals applying to and choosing careers in certain medical fields, such as nursing. This shortage in nursing personnel is expected to persist for the foreseeable future. Additionally, some individuals continue to grapple with the psychological aftermath of managing a disease for which we initially lacked adequate answers. The experience of watching patients succumb to a respiratory disease without having a definitive solution has been humbling and emotionally challenging. Similar to how we address PTSD in the military, we must acknowledge healthcare professionals' ongoing struggles in coping with the disease's management.

Furthermore, the economic climate poses considerable difficulty for healthcare institutions. Coupled with this is the need to strategically position ourselves differently. For instance, recent reports indicate a concerning shift in the production of personal protective equipment (PPE), with a significant percentage moving offshore. This raises questions about our ability to ensure a stable supply of essential items and avoid exorbitant prices during negotiations for critical resources like masks. Additionally, we must address concerns related to engineering aspects, such as air movement, to safeguard our institutions effectively.

Navigating these challenges while maintaining the delivery of high-quality care to all patients is an immense task. Undoubtedly, this period presents challenges for leaders in the healthcare industry. Striking the delicate balance between growth, innovation, and the well-being of our healthcare professionals requires careful consideration and a deep appreciation for what they have endured.

Could you provide some insight into the best practices you have implemented to address staff shortages and enhance their preparedness in infection control? Considering that the ultimate impact of these practices directly affects the patients, have you observed significant outcomes due to these measures?

We have implemented several key practices to address areas of weakness and enhance our preparedness for infection control. Firstly, we identified the weakest points in our processes, particularly those influenced by variables beyond our immediate control. One such area was the availability of personal protective equipment (PPE), including masks and gowns. We revamped our storage and inventory management systems to address this, acquiring a large warehouse with an advanced logistics system. This investment ensures a responsible and continuous supply of PPE to meet the needs of our community.

Additionally, we have developed protocols that acknowledge the potential for future pandemics. Recognizing that the magnitude of COVID-19 has been unprecedented in recent history, we understand that globalization and changing climate patterns may lead to similar events in our lifetime. As a result, we engage in discussions and strategic planning for future outbreaks, ensuring that we are prepared to effectively manage them.

A crucial aspect of our approach is building robust processes rather than relying solely on individuals. For instance, when transitioning leadership roles in infection prevention, we have established best practices that facilitate a seamless transfer of responsibilities. This continuity ensures that our efforts in infection control remain strong, regardless of personnel changes.

Furthermore, we have embraced collaboration across different health systems. We can share insights and learn from one another by fostering better communication and partnerships with organizations like Hartford and Trinity. This includes engaging with health systems outside our state, allowing us to gain valuable knowledge and promptly implement proactive measures to detect and respond to emerging diseases or shifts in epidemiology.

What trends do you foresee considering the future of infection control over the next 12 to 18 months? Specifically, do you anticipate any changes in technology adoption or the emergence of new technologies? Are there any other best practices that will be crucial during this timeframe?

One of the most significant lessons we've learned from COVID-19 is the importance of community education. We dedicated substantial resources and time during the pandemic to ensure that people are well-informed about the necessary actions to stay safe. Moving forward, there will be a focus on improving communication with individuals in the community and providing them with clear guidelines for their safety when they visit healthcare facilities.

Moreover, infection prevention offers an epidemiological approach that can be further enhanced through advanced data analysis. Artificial Intelligence (AI) has made significant advancements in various industries, and I believe we can leverage AI to better assess risk factors and predict infections. By utilizing algorithms and criteria based on individual health elements, we can identify patients with a higher risk of specific infections, such as CLABSI or surgical site infections. Implementing these algorithms can significantly improve patient safety post-procedure.

While developing technology tailored specifically for healthcare can be challenging, we must explore models prioritizing prevention rather than reactive control. Machine learning and AI are likely to play a significant role in infection prevention within the healthcare industry, and we are already witnessing promising advancements in this field. Several companies are actively working on solutions in this area, and it will be interesting to see their progress in the coming months.
